Here's a nice task for anybody who does desktop programming. Make a nice UI
for creating Plucker-compatible font packages from fonts supplied by the
user, using fontconv and topalmtext as conversion engines.
Currently, my fontconv and topalmtext utilities
(palmfontconv.sourceforge.net) can together convert half a dozen or more
font formats (anything FreeType 2 supports, plus any Palm-specific format)
into any Palm format (nfnt/NFNT/afnx). The UI would let the user choose the
sources for the fonts Plucker needs in a custom user package (standard,
bold, large, large bold, fixed--I may be missing something), run the
required utilities for converting fonts, and produce a nice little .prc
(e.g., by calling par, which we should be able to bundle, though I don't
remember its license). If we did this really well, we could also call par
to rip apart font packages (or even program binaries) in other formats
(FontHack, Fonts4NX, etc.), and extract the fonts for use in Plucker.
All this can be done by calling already-written tools. It's really just a
matter of making a nice UI. I don't know how to do desktop GUI based
programming (except for a bit of Visual Basic) and I haven't the time. I
think this would be a nice project for someone.
And it would be really easy, once the antialiased font support is in, to
extend the UI to generate antialiased fonts. (Currently topalmtext extracts
antialiased grayscale bitmaps from outline fonts, but I don't have any
utility written yet to convert it to the format I want to use for
antialiased fonts.)
